Davies struggles during third round at U.S. Open

Saturday, June 19, 2010

JOHNSON CITY, Tenn. (June 19, 2010) - After a strong performance during Friday's second round at the U.S. Open, former ETSU All American Rhys Davies (Bridgend, Wales) struggled during Saturday's third round, carding an 8-over-par 79 to fall into a tie for 72nd at the Pebble Beach Golf Links.

 

Davies' day included just one birdie on the fourth hole, while a double bogey and seven bogeys dropped him from a tie for 50th to his current standing. He presently sits at 14-over-par 227 for the tournament and will attempt to improve on those numbers during Sunday's final round.

 

It has been a memorable week for Davies, who made the cut for the first time in a major event after participating in the 2007 U.S. Open and the 2009 British Open.
